Nightmares may be more frightening if you’re a child and don’t understand what’s behind them. The Mayo Clinic explains potential causes for bad dreams:

* Daily events that cause stress, or major life changes (such as a move or loss in the family).
* A traumatic accident or injury.
* Insufficient sleep.
* Some medications, such as antidepressants.
* Certain health conditions, such as significant anxiety.
* Abusing or withdrawing from drugs.
* Watching a scary movie or reading a scary book.
